Doc Martin star Natalia Dontcheva dies aged 56 after long illness
Natalia Dontcheva dies aged 56 after long illness

Doc Martin star Natalia Dontcheva has died aged 56 after a decade-long illness.

The Bulgarian actress's stepson, film producer Hugo Selignac, paid tribute to her on Instagram, writing in French alongside a headshot. He said: 'I never liked the title "stepmother" – because when we met, I was no longer a child, and I'd already had a stepmother before.'

'A truly beautiful person'

Selignac continued: 'But you have no idea what a truly beautiful person I found you to be, or how deeply I loved who you were.' He thanked her for the bond she fought to nurture within their family and for the confidence she instilled in him.

He also spoke of her relationship with his father, director Arnaud Selignac, Dontcheva's partner of 25 years. 'Thank you for helping our dad be a better one, but most of all thank you for caring for him for 25 years, thank you for admiring, caring, supporting, forgiving and most of all loving passionately.'

Hinting at Dontcheva's illness, Selignac concluded: 'After a ten-year battle, you are finally going to rest. Enjoy it to the fullest; it's been so long since you've had that chance. I will miss you, my beautiful Natalia.'

Agent confirms death

Dontcheva's agent Laurent Savry confirmed the star's death to The Sun, without sharing further details of her illness. He said: 'It is with immense sadness that we announce the passing of Natalia Dontcheva.'

'A profoundly talented artist and woman of great sensitivity, Natalia Dontcheva touched audiences with the precision of her performances, her elegance and her dedication to her craft. Throughout her career, she earned the respect of her co-stars, directors, film crews and all who had the privilege of working alongside her.'

Doc Martin role

Dontcheva played Julie Derville in the Cornwall-set ITV show for four years, appearing across 26 episodes.
